The Transformation of Online Casinos: From Promises to Trust
Historically, online casino platforms faced skepticism regarding fairness, security, and transparency. While the allure of digital gambling grew, so did concerns about unregulated operators and unfair practices. Industry analysts emphasize that establishing trust hinges on transparency, licensing, and the deployment of cutting-edge technology.
In recent years, the advent of blockchain verification, state-of-the-art RNGs (Random Number Generators), and rigorous licensing standards have significantly improved reputation and reliability. Players now seek not just entertainment but also assurance of fairness and security.

Key Factors in Assessing Casino Platforms
| Criteria | Description | Industry Benchmark |
|---|---|---|
| Licensing & Regulation | Adherence to jurisdictional laws ensures compliance and player protection. | Malta Gaming Authority, UK Gambling Commission |
| Fairness & Transparency | Use of certified RNGs and provably fair algorithms. | Third-party audits by eCOGRA, iTech Labs |
| User Experience & Accessibility | Intuitive interfaces tailored to diverse devices and user needs. | Mobile optimisation, multilingual support |
| Security Measures | SSL encryption, data privacy, and secure payment methods. | ISO/IEC 27001 standards |
